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Warner Ranch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Warner Ranch?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Warner Ranch is at Strada listed at $1,184.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Warner Ranch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Warner Ranch is $2,398.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Warner Ranch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Warner Ranch is a 1,524 square feet unit starting from $2,371 at Indigo.

What is the average size for Warner Ranch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Warner Ranch is currently at 713 sq ft.
